| from pathlib import Path |
| from src.safe_subprocess import run |
|
|
| def eval_script(path): |
| |
| |
| |
| with open(path, 'r') as f: |
| content = f.read() |
| content = f"test();\n{content}" |
| with open(path, 'w') as f: |
| f.write(content) |
| filename = path.stem |
| parent_dir = path.parent.absolute() |
|
|
| |
| |
| |
| |
| |
| program= f""" |
| import matlab.engine |
| import io |
| import sys |
| out = io.StringIO() |
| err = io.StringIO() |
| eng = matlab.engine.start_matlab() |
| eng.addpath(r'{parent_dir}',nargout=0) |
| try: |
| r = eng.{filename}(nargout=0, stdout=out,stderr=err) |
| print(out.getvalue()) |
| except matlab.engine.MatlabExecutionError as e: |
| print(err.getvalue(), file=sys.stderr) |
| """ |
| r = run(["python3", "-c", program], timeout_seconds=30) |
|
|
| |
| if r.timeout: |
| status = "Timeout" |
| exit_code = -1 |
| elif r.stderr == "": |
| status = "OK" |
| exit_code = 0 |
| else: |
| status = "Exception" |
| exit_code = 1 |
|
|
| return { |
| "status": status, |
| "exit_code": exit_code, |
| "stdout": r.stdout, |
| "stderr": r.stderr, |
| } |
